[tests] move unittest import to main
authorPaul Brossier <piem@piem.org>
Thu, 1 Nov 2018 21:03:02 +0000 (22:03 +0100)
committerPaul Brossier <piem@piem.org>
Thu, 1 Nov 2018 21:03:02 +0000 (22:03 +0100)
python/tests/test_slicing.py
python/tests/test_specdesc.py
python/tests/test_zero_crossing_rate.py

index 1d8e42f..2ad84f4 100755 (executable)
@@ -1,6 +1,5 @@
 #! /usr/bin/env python
 
-from unittest import main
 from numpy.testing import TestCase, assert_equal
 from aubio import slice_source_at_stamps
 from .utils import count_files_in_directory, get_default_test_sound
@@ -167,4 +166,5 @@ class aubio_slicing_wrong_ends_test_case(TestCase):
         shutil.rmtree(self.output_dir)
 
 if __name__ == '__main__':
+    from unittest import main
     main()
index d7769dc..32a46fe 100755 (executable)
@@ -1,6 +1,5 @@
 #! /usr/bin/env python
 
-from unittest import main
 from numpy.testing import TestCase, assert_equal, assert_almost_equal
 from numpy import random, arange, log, zeros
 from aubio import specdesc, cvec, float_type
@@ -229,4 +228,5 @@ class aubio_specdesc_wrong(TestCase):
             specdesc("unknown", 512)
 
 if __name__ == '__main__':
+    from unittest import main
     main()
index 7f6d479..21f9e40 100755 (executable)
@@ -1,6 +1,5 @@
 #! /usr/bin/env python
 
-from unittest import main
 from numpy.testing import TestCase
 from aubio import fvec, zero_crossing_rate
 
@@ -43,4 +42,5 @@ class zero_crossing_rate_test_case(TestCase):
         self.assertEqual(2./buf_size, zero_crossing_rate(self.vector))
 
 if __name__ == '__main__':
+    from unittest import main
     main()